How to convert Light Years to Kilometers (ly to km)?
1 ly = 9461000000000 km.
300 x 9461000000000 km = 2838300000000000 Kilometers.

A light-year (abbreviation: ly), sometimes referred to incorrectly as a light year, is a unit of length used informally to express astronomical distances. It is approxi ..more definition+

The kilometer (SI symbol: km) or kilometre (British spelling) is a unit of length in the metric system, equal to 1000 meters (kilo- being the SI prefix for 1000). It is ..more definition+

In relation to the base unit of [length] => (meters), 1 Light Years (ly) is equal to 9461000000000000 meters, while 1 Kilometers (km) = 1000 meters.
